Step 1: Containment and Assessment
Our team will quickly contain the water spill to prevent further damage, then assess the extent of the flooding. This involves taking moisture readings and identifying the source of the leak.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use industrial-grade pumps to extract as much water as possible from your home. This is where our equipment really shines, allowing us to remove water quickly and efficiently.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Next,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ry your home, including dehumidifiers and air movers.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and ensuring your home is safe to inhabit.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Once your home is dry, we’ll clean and sanitize all affected areas to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ria.
Step 5: Restoration and Repairs
Finally, we’ll work with you to restore your home to its original condition, including any necessary repairs to walls, floors, and ceilings.

Busted Pipe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ak, easy to fix | Yes | No | You can fix it yourself with some basic plumbing knowledge. |
| Large water spill, multiple rooms affected | No | Yes | It’s too much for a DIY project and needs professional equipment and expertise. |
| Hidden water damage, behind walls or under flooring | No | Yes | You can’t see the damage, and it needs specialized equipment to detect and repair. |
| Emergency situation, water damage spreading fast | No | Yes | Time is of the essence, and you need a team that can respond quickly and effectively. |
| Insurance claim, need professional documentation | No | Yes | Our team will work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process. |
| Health concerns, mold or mildew growth | No | Yes | Our team has the expertise and equipment to safely remove mold and mildew. |

What Causes Broken Pipes?
Broken pipes can be caused by a variety of factors, including aging pipes, corrosion, freezing temperatures, and high water pressure. Our team can help you identify the cause of the issue and recommend the best course of action.
